What is RAID (redundant series of independent disks)?

Raid, which means a redundant series of independent (or cheap, depending on who you are asking), is the category of disk units that use two or more hard drives to ensure that the data is safely stored.

There are several different RAID levels, each with its own specific data protection method stored on each hard disk. Some of the most commonly used are:

RAID 0 : This type contains data streaming that spreads parts of the file via multiple units. This is used to increase performance, but if one unit fails, the data in the field is lost. Raid 5 : This is perhaps the most popular type of Raid field. This type contains Stripping RAID 0 as well as error correction, resulting in a combination of excellent performance and failure tolerance.

Using RAID in personal computers is slowly on the rise. Previously, the higher cost of hard drives compatible with RAID undesirable to the general public. RAID is widely used in top -class computers and business computing environments; It is slowly looking for land in the home because prices are still decreasing.

The

combination of high performance and data protection makes RAID a heavy choice to refuse, especially, because more and more people depend on hard drives to keep important data safe.
